Who started 100+ Women Who Care?

100+ Women Who Care was founded by Karen Dunigan of Jackson, Michigan in 2006. Her group of 100 women raised over $12,800 at its first meeting to purchase 300 new baby cribs for a local nonprofit agency.


Since then, over 350 chapters (which include Men, People and Kids Who Care chapters) have been launched around the world in a like-minded effort to make a positive difference on a local level.


The 100+ Women Who Care Sault Ste. Marie chapter was founded in 2016 by 5 community-minded women who sought to make a difference in Sault Ste. Marie. The founding members include:

  • Sandra Hollingsworth
  • Patricia (Murielle) McGrath
  • Cathy Shunock
  • Marnie Stone
  • Rosetta Sicoli


After the first meeting in May 2015, Tracey Fyfe joined the executive committee.


In June 2017, Gabrielle Fogg also joined the executive committee. 


In 2019, Toni Lukenda also joined the executive committee.
